Payroll outsourcing to straighten things out

Judging by its current track record, the practice of payroll outsourcing is going to be one of the most inherent aspects of business in a few years.

The HR outsourcing industry has witnessed a huge increase in its numbers as evidenced by various researches conducted. As the global economy becomes increasingly unpredictable and risk-prone, the emphasis on cost reduction becomes more prominent. And so this stimulates the outsourcing industry, the effects of which trickle down to payroll outsourcing.

Now, the process of reimbursing employees in a typical corporate environment is complicated and resource-intensive, particularly with a large workforce. Sometimes this requires the practice of outsourcing payroll tasks to an outside agency that has the necessary resources and offers its services at a price that fits your budget. In fact, saving money turns out to be one of the most sought-after reasons for outsourcing payroll.

Several elements are combined to form a payslip: it has the gross salary divided into a series of segregations that involve registered pay, bonuses, overtime, travel allowances, severance pay and many more. No matter how simple you’re trying to keep things in your organization, the payroll scheme of things will always be multi-layered and require great attention to detail.

Managing payroll can be a demanding task, requiring large amounts of data to be managed and managed accurately. Keeping up with this large amount of data could lead to some discrepancies. With payroll outsourcing, you can offload this task to an outside resource so you can focus your internal resources on the most core operations of your organization.

So, if you are looking towards payroll outsourcing, you should be absolutely sure that you hire the services of a company that is trustworthy and has positive word of mouth in the market. There are several concerns floating around the outsourcing phenomenon that are often well founded if you outsource the work to companies with poor work ethics and distrustful reputations. Some of these concerns include data insecurity, lack of control over the entire process, lack of access to reports, etc. And that’s why you can’t go with the first outsourcing service provider you come across. The company you choose should be the result of extensive research and a few references.

The most reliable payroll outsourcing service providers also use the most advanced technologies so that the tasks are expedited and accurate to the highest degree. This is another added advantage of signing up with them. So spend more time getting to know your outsourcing partner and make sure you’re investing in the well-being of your organization.
